Which mode is better for eyes
Summary: In people with normal vision (or corrected-to-normal vision), visual performance tends to be better with light mode, whereas some people with cataract and related disorders may perform better with dark mode. On the flip side, long-term reading in light mode may be associated with myopia.
Is Dark mode better on your eyes
Dark mode may be a personal preference for some, but it isn’t necessarily better for your eyes. It also isn’t a substitute for better methods to reduce eye strain, DeBroff says. To prevent and treat eye strain, he recommends: Giving your eyes a rest from screens every 20 minutes.

Is low brightness better for your eyes
Myth: Reading in dim light will worsen your vision. Fact: Although dim lighting will not adversely affect your eyesight, it will tire your eyes out more quickly.
